Exploring $3000 Loans without Credit Checks
$3000 loans without credit checks, also known as no-credit-check loans, are short-term borrowing options designed for individuals who may have difficulty accessing traditional financing due to poor credit history or a lack of credit history. Unlike conventional loans, which typically require a thorough credit assessment, these loans rely on other factors such as income, employment status, and banking history to determine eligibility. As a result, they offer a lifeline to those in need of immediate financial assistance, providing access to funds without the hassle of a credit check.

Understanding Loan Terms and Conditions
While $3000 loans without credit checks offer immediate access to funds, it’s essential for borrowers to understand the terms and conditions of the loan. This includes reviewing the loan amount, interest rate, repayment period, and any associated fees or penalties. No-credit-check loans typically come with higher interest rates and shorter repayment terms compared to traditional loans, reflecting the increased risk for lenders. Borrowers should carefully evaluate these factors to ensure that the loan aligns with their financial capabilities and repayment ability.

Responsible Borrowing Practices
While $3000 loans without credit checks offer quick access to funds, it’s essential for borrowers to practice responsible borrowing habits. These loans should be used judiciously and for legitimate financial needs rather than frivolous expenses. Borrowers should only borrow what they need and can afford to repay, and should avoid rolling over or extending loans, which can lead to a cycle of debt. By borrowing responsibly, individuals can mitigate financial risks and maintain their long-term financial well-being.
